The Role

Lead Luanda Ports & Terminals Operations. Control daily Container, GC/Bulk operations, Planning, and Safety; plan and monitor terminal capacity to ensure the necessary capacity based on business forecasts and to achieve the Company's profit, revenue, and operational goals.

The position is responsible for overseeing daily port activities, ensuring efficient operations, compliance with safety standards, and alignment with business goals. This role includes strategic planning, capacity management, stakeholder engagement, and promoting a culture of safety and excellence in line with policies and Principles. 


Key Responsibilities

• Implement, direct, and administer the general policies established; develop the Business Unit's annual and long-term (business) plans, and plan, develop, and approve specific policies, programs, procedures, and operational methods in line with the general policies.

• Ensure there are adequate resources, skilled labour, and equipment to sufficiently support daily operations.

• Plan, develop, and implement strategies to accommodate terminal capacity expansion to meet current and future organizational needs.

• Take a leadership role in establishing performance indicators for all operational directorate functions and monitor performance against operational goals.

• Conduct weekly meetings to report on terminal performance and other significant activities.

• Maintain close contact with shipping companies, logistics firms, customs agents, transportation companies, customs authorities, port authorities, and other legal authorities to ensure their requirements are met.

• Establish port operations according to plans, standards, and procedures consistent with global policies.

• Establish and implement current and long-term goals, objectives, plans, and policies for port operations, technical activities, and expansion.

• Provide input for effective strategies to operate the terminal at optimal levels within operational opportunities and constraints.

• Be responsible for leading most of the main functions of the Port, maintaining and creating safe working conditions while ensuring and maintaining high productivity and economical operations.

• Take a leadership role in selecting, negotiating, and finalizing agreements with suppliers and customers, and where appropriate, be responsible for executing and maintaining agreed service levels.

• Provide a working strategy for the IT function and support and contribute to technological and systems development as applicable to improve cost efficiency, productivity, and customer service.

• Ensure compliance with HSE (Health, Safety, and Environment) policies and procedures.
